Armenian Prime Minister Karen Karapetyan on Wednesday attended the session of the Eurasian Intergovernmental Council in Moscow.
The draft Customs Code of the EAEU was discussed and approved at the session, the press-service of the Armenian Government informed Armenian News – NEWS.am.
Legal norms regulating the circulation of medicines in the common market were also approved at the session. Pursuant to them, a common market for medicines will operate in the EAEU territory staring from 1 January 2017. The pharmaceutical organizations registered in all member-states will be provided free circulation in the EAEU territory.
The next session of the Council will be held in the first quarter of 2017 in Bishkek.
